Output fdf4d54d66a2d885065d418f8049f1bc8b9eb62c676f538b088859491f7ef72c:71

value
8660
script pubkey
OP_0 OP_PUSHBYTES_20 2bf7fc2a9bc6804c1109b279375895b775108382
address
bc1q90mlc25mc6qycygfkfunwky4ka63pquzmtjmdu
transaction
fdf4d54d66a2d885065d418f8049f1bc8b9eb62c676f538b088859491f7ef72c
confirmations
28713
spent
true